Output 34afc326f5fb99ef14692ed0fc097c7b30d2a4ef95007c66883b8fef678fb26d:1

value
78869901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0acbbecdea71aee4a40d1a01f4dd585763993c3d OP_EQUAL
address
32g6kwE4R4F4qP4e4SK567qj4btRU7QEY3
transaction
34afc326f5fb99ef14692ed0fc097c7b30d2a4ef95007c66883b8fef678fb26d
spent
true